Hi Johannes

I have here 2 600A power stages in one casing. Since we now know your software reliably works i propose a crazy idea.
What if i would parallel both sides of Volt inverter?
My plan is the following:
1. I will use two inverter chips SN74LS06 and ill feed them from a single input being Olimex STM32 chip.
2. I will also parallel current sensor inputs. Volt inverter current inputs are allready all in one place. Now to do paralleling i propose to feed from each symmetrical sensor signal each through a 2K2 resistors then join that 5V signal and pull it down by 3K3 resistor. That will again form divider 1K2/3K3. By then signal will be muxed and if any sensor will go off chart it will trip OC circuit because of misproportion. Do you think it will work?

I have put the boards for manufacture. I made two concepts. First is interface board to connect Rev 2 johannes main board and entails sensor and driver parts.
Second is complete Volt inverter board with one motor controler and parallel outputs - or not if you choose to only use one side. Additionally there is a lebowski brain to drive AC compressor. Both drives have CAN bus interfaces.
